For millions of individuals navigating the challenges of modern life, insomnia and anxiety have become frequent and frustrating companions. While pharmaceutical sleep aids remain a common recourse, increasing attention has turned to nutritional strategies as safer, sustainable, and scientifically valid solutions. The emerging field of nutritional psychiatry emphasizes that the food we consume can directly influence our neurochemistry, impacting everything from our mood to the quality and structure of our sleep. Specifically, certain types of protein and serotonin-enhancing foods have been shown to support deeper, more restorative sleep without interfering with REM cycles—an essential phase for emotional regulation and cognitive repair.

At the heart of our sleep-wake patterns lies the circadian rhythm—a natural, internal process that regulates the sleep-wake cycle and repeats roughly every 24 hours. This biological clock is influenced by environmental cues, such as light and temperature, and plays a critical role in determining when we feel alert or sleepy.
